Practical Tips for Summer Hobbies

1. Explore Outdoor Activities

Unleash your adventurous side! Here are some fun outdoor hobbies:

  • Gardening: Get your hands dirty and grow some flowers or vegetables. It’s rewarding and soothing.
  • Hiking: Find local trails and enjoy nature while listening to your favorite Rolling Stones tracks.
  • Photography: Capture the beauty of summer. Use your phone or a camera to document your adventures.

2. Embrace Creative Arts

Channel your inner artist:

How to boost your mood with summer hobbies inspired by the Rolling Stones related image
  • Painting or Drawing: Let your imagination run wild. Use vibrant colors that reflect the energy of summer.
  • Writing: Start a journal or write poetry inspired by the music of the Rolling Stones.
  • Crafting: Try making DIY projects that bring joy, like creating summer-themed decorations.

3. Join a Music or Dance Class

Music is a powerful mood booster:

  • Learn an Instrument: Pick up a guitar and strum away to your favorite Stones songs.
  • Dance Classes: Find a local class and groove to the rhythm of summer.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are some easy summer hobbies for beginners?

Start with gardening, hiking, or simple crafts. These activities are enjoyable and easy to learn.

How can music improve my mood?

Listening to music can release feel-good chemicals in the brain, reducing stress and enhancing happiness.

Can I combine hobbies?

Absolutely! For instance, you can combine photography with hiking or painting outdoors.

How much time should I dedicate to hobbies?

Even 30 minutes a week can make a difference. Find what works best for you.

What if I don’t have anyone to join me?

Many hobbies can be enjoyed solo. You might find it refreshing to have some time to yourself!
